Day 2 - Lock Haven, PA to Milroy, PA

Day 2 of our Middle Atlantic Backroad Discovery Route (MABDR).
Started in Lock Haven, PA and finished in Milroy, PA.
We spent most of the day in the Bald Eagle State Forest.
We stopped at Penns View Overlook to see the bridge over Penns Creek far in the distance.
The early morning part of the ride just out of Lock Haven was very beautiful at perfect temperatures around 68-70F (20-21C).
One of the most interesting things we saw was a small town that had the Main Street lined up with the Red, White and Blue. Underneath each flag they had a picture and a name of a young person that lived in the area and had joined the armed forces. They called them Home Town Heroes.
Although temperatures were high, maximum of 91F (33C) as we spent most of the time inside the forest under shade, we found it easier to cope than yesterday.
Riding was in general quite easy but we did get a couple of gnarly sections to keep us awake.
Had lunch in Harvey’s Food Mart outside of Hartleton, PA and we had a “dumpster”. Not as smelly and much tastier though.
As we arrived early there was time to do a machine full of washing.
For dinner we went to the Bel-Vue Inn which was very good.
